A Sturdy Folding Easel for Artists
If you’re someone who loves to paint, draw, or do any kind of artistic work, then you know how important it is to have a designated space in your house for all your supplies. However, not everyone has a dedicated studio or extra room just for their creative endeavors.
A folding easel is a compact, portable version of the traditional artist’s easel. You can fold it up and store it away when not in use, making it perfect for those with limited space.

A Set of Clear Bins for Sewing Supplies
Sewing supplies can quickly get out of hand. The varieties of yarn, the collection of buttons and thread, and the must-have sewing needles are tangled and lost. You spend 20 minutes searching for supplies instead of sewing!
Clear bins are perfect for easily finding what you need while keeping the items separated. Label the bins clearly and arrange them on a durable shelving unit or in a closed cabinet to keep the space tidy.
A Rolling Utility Cart
Move around the space with all your supplies by your side with a rolling utility cart. Whether you enjoy painting, sewing, scrapbooking, or even baking, this mobile resource will ensure your tools are accessible no matter where you move.
A Slatwall System for Gaming Consoles
Art isn’t the only hobby; gamers need an efficient and creative way to organize their interests at home. Avid gamers have several consoles that can be difficult to set up when wanting to play something different. Slatwall is the solution you’ve been searching for.
The primary difference between slatwall and pegboards is that pegboards are solely beneficial for crafting stations and tool storage in garages. Slatwall, on the other hand, can accommodate every requirement a gamer needs.
Imagine displaying your consoles and switching between them with ease. Select heavy-duty shelves that attach to the wall-mounted panel. Be sure that the shelves are customized to accommodate the dimensions of each console. This eye-catching change will free up valuable desk space for a clutter-free gaming environment.
A Few Bookcases for Organizing Video Game Supplies
If you have trouble finding a place for every gaming accessory, bookcases are stylish and efficient additions. There’s a place for everything from remote controls to game cases, memorabilia, and headsets.
Assess how much storage space you need and the size of your bookcases. You can choose to have one large bookcase or several smaller ones.
Use one shelf for game cases, another for controllers and remotes, and a third for memorabilia like figurines or art books. Then, consider using a small basket or tray on one of the shelves to keep headsets easily accessible.
